  3. 10 de may. de 2024 · Monte Carlo method, statistical method of understanding complex physical or mathematical systems by using randomly generated numbers as input into those systems to generate a range of solutions. The likelihood of a particular solution can be found by dividing the number of times that solution was.

  4. Hace 1 día · For the Monte-Carlo simulation of gas-generator cycle liquid rocket engine, we first construct a one-dimensional numerical model. For this purpose, we use EcosimPro V6.4 software, which is a low-order (0-D and 1-D) numerical analysis software developed by Empresarios Agrupados Internacional for various engineering practices, with a focus on aerospace applications.
